Job SummaryResponsible for performing the underwriting analysis for OMIC insureds and applicants.ResponsibilitiesUsing a thorough understanding of OMIC’s philosophy and guidelines, exercise judgment and apply a variety of factors to answer rating and coverage inquiries from prospective applicants. Provide information and advice on coverage issues to policyholders.Evaluate and process applications from prospective insureds and renewals to determine underwriting acceptability in accordance with the general underwriting policies and standards.Identify marginal risks and prepare files for Manager or Physician Review.Actively pursue the solicitation of new insureds. Provide quotations to acceptable applicants.Works in collaboration with other departments, such as Marketing & Sales, Risk Management, and Claims, to ensure proper coverage is in place and appropriate services are provided to the client.Draft and issue declination letters to unacceptable applicants.Prepare policy declarations, endorsements, and other policyholder‑specific documents.Evaluate requests for optional coverage and coverage changes.Represent OMIC marketing booth at the AAO Annual Meeting or other regional, state or national meetings and/or functions as needed. Visit insured and prospective insured offices to develop relations and act as a representative of OMIC.Work closely with underwriting team members to ensure the Underwriting Department runs smoothly. This includes keeping electronic files current and having the ability to assess situations and provide resources needed to other team members.Train Associates and Assistants to develop their knowledge of OMIC practices and philosophies. Provide feedback on their work performance. Delegate administrative tasks to the Underwriting Associates/Assistants and clerks.Mentor other Underwriters.Engage in Company‑wide teams and initiatives when requested.Work closely with other departments, especially Risk Management and Accounting, to resolve practice and/or payment issues.Special projects as assigned.Education & ExperienceCollege degree or equivalent work experienceA minimum of 5 years’ previous insurance underwriting experience preferredMedical malpractice experience preferredRequired Aptitudes and SkillsExcellent oral, written, and customer service skillsStrong analytical judgmentStrong proficiency with MS 365 (including Word and Excel)Ability to work well independently and as part of a teamFamiliarity with insurance terminologyPhysical RequirementsThe physical demands described herein are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job.
